Subject: [GIT PULL for v3.8-rc5] media fixes
Date: Wed, 23 Jan 2013 19:05:45 -0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20130123190545.781e4468@redhat.com> (raw)

Hi Linus,

Please pull from:
  git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/mchehab/linux-media v4l_for_linus

For some fixes:
	- gspca: add needed delay for I2C traffic for sonixb/sonixj cameras;
	- gspca: add one missing Kinect USB ID;
	- usbvideo: some regression fixes;
	- omap3isp: fix some build issues;
	- videobuf2: fix video output handling;
	- exynos s5p/m5mols: a few regression fixes.
